How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Powderhouse/Powder House?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Powderhouse/Powder House Studio Apartments | $2,559 | $2,150 | $3,600 |
Powderhouse/Powder House 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,000 | $1,350 | $4,195 |
| Powderhouse/Powder House 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,544 | $2,500 | $4,629 |
| Powderhouse/Powder House 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,096 | $1,175 | $5,400 |
| Powderhouse/Powder House 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,817 | $3,000 | $6,900 |
| Powderhouse/Powder House 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,827 | $4,595 | $6,750 |
